Roast Chicken with Roasted Vegetables and Salad calories & nutrition


Roast Chicken with Roasted Vegetables and Salad contains 875 calories per serving (44% of a 2,000 kcal daily diet), with 41g fat, 84g carbs, and 40g protein. This nutrition data is based on real meals tracked by Arise app users.

What's in Roast Chicken with Roasted Vegetables and Salad?


Ingredient Amount kcal Fat Carb Protein
Roast Chicken Thigh with Glaze 150 g 390 25 10 30
Roasted Sweet Potato 100 g 90 2 17 1
Roasted Potato 80 g 80 2 14 1
Roasted Red Onion 30 g 20 0 5 1
Mixed Leaf Salad 50 g 15 0 3 1
Yorkshire Pudding with Mayonnaise 60 g 180 12 12 4
Baked Potato 120 g 100 0 23 2


Macronutrients (Fat, Carbs, Protein) are shown in grams (g).
